dmaengine: rcar-dmac: Make DMAC reinit during system resume explicit
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The current (empty) system sleep callbacks rely on the PM core to force
a runtime resume to reinitialize the DMAC registers during system
resume.  Without a reinitialization, e.g. SCIF DMA will hang silently
after a system resume on R-Car Gen3.

Make this explicit by using pm_runtime_force_{suspend,resume}() as the
system sleep callbacks instead.  Use SET_LATE_SYSTEM_SLEEP_PM_OPS() as
DMA engines must be initialized before all DMA slave devices.

Fixes: 17218e0 "PM / genpd: Stop/start devices without pm_runtime_force_suspend/resume()"
